Ricardo Vaz Te has been reunited with West Ham manager Sam Allardyce after the striker signed from Barnsley for an undisclosed fee.

The former Portugal Under-21 international was first brought to England by Allardyce when he was in charge of Bolton.

The 25-year-old, who has scored 10 goals in 12 starts for the Tykes this season, has signed a two-and-a-half-year deal at the Boleyn Ground.

He told West Ham's official website: "I feel great. I'm very excited to work with Sam again and it's great because I know a few players here.

"I'm very thankful and excited and looking forward to it.

"I had a fantastic time at Barnsley. I'm very grateful for the opportunity they gave me and I hope the fans can understand why I left as West Ham is a great opportunity for me."
